Born
in Scandinavia, in the north country of Finland, Sari Rouhento enjoyed
a childhood of winter magic and the "nightless nights" of
Midsummer. Introduced to various forms of traditional craftsmanship
by her grandparents, Ms. Rouhento was involved in numerous craft styles
from an early age. She also developed an interest in photographing nature,
cityscapes and people.
The adventurous
teenager traveled around Europe and Northern Africa, documenting life
through photography. She spent time in Paris, where art floated in the
air. Ms. Rouhento traveled throughout the world, studying all forms
of art while exploring her creativity. As she landed in New York in
the early 90's her creative edge and success as an artist took off.
At the time she concentrated in photography and sculpture.
Ms. Rouhento
is a successful bicontinental artist based out of Santa Fe,
New Mexico. After extensive work in other creative arts, she has
found her passion in the making of large format pastel paintings,
with her signature blend of gestural abstraction. This multi-faceted
artist is also experienced in film, dance and performance arts. Her
experience in film enables her to direct, film and edit. In addition
to her busy schedule, Ms. Rouhento is also a songwriter.
